Product Description

Primarily supports legacy methods. BioSuite Peptide Analysis columns consist of two premier reversed-phase column chemistries specifically optimized for peptide mapping from simple to complicated digests. BioSuite PA Columns are available in various configurations for LC or LC-MS applications, including 250 mm lengths for ultra high resolution.   These BioSuite PA-A and PA-B columns provide excellent batch-to-batch reproducibility for consistent results and are uniquely QC tested specifically for peptide mapping.  BioSuite C18 3 µm PA-A is a 100Å, difunctional bonded, low ligand density, silica-based reversed-phase column and  BioSuite C18 3.5 µm PA-B is a 300Å, high ligand density, monofunctional, silica-based  reversed-phase column.

Specifications

  • Chemistry

    C18

  • Separation Mode

    Reversed Phase

  • Particle Substrate

    Silica

  • pH Range Min

    2 pH

  • pH Range Max

    8 pH

  • Maximum Pressure

    6000 psi (415 Bar)

  • Endcapped

    Yes

  • Molecular Weight Range Min

    1000

  • Molecular Weight Range Max

    30000

  • Particle Shape

    Spherical

  • Particle Size

    3.5 µm

  • Endfitting Type

    Waters

  • Pore Size

    300 Å

  • Format

    Column

  • System

    HPLC

  • USP Classification

    L1

  • Inner Diameter

    4.6 mm

  • Length

    250 mm

  • Carbon Load

    8.5 %

  • UNSPSC

    41115709

  • Application

    Peptide

  • Brand

    BioSuite

  • Product Type

    Columns

  • Units per Package

    1 pk
